What is a Core Charge?

A core charge (also called "core deposit") is similar to the deposit you might pay for a can or bottle of soda and is a standard requirement in the auto parts industry. For example, in many states, to promote recycling, you pay a deposit when you purchase a can of soda and receive your deposit back when you return the empty can. Many automotive parts have a core charge, or core price, that works in essentially the same way as a soda can deposit.

Fuel injectors play a crucial role in delivering the right amount of fuel to the engine for optimal performance and efficiency. When a fuel injector begins to fail, it can lead to a range of issues that affect your vehicle’s drivability. While it might be tempting to continue driving with a bad fuel injector, doing so can lead to more severe problems and potentially costly repairs. In this blog, we’ll discuss whether you can drive with a malfunctioning fuel injector and the risks involved.

  • Engine Performance Issues

    •  A bad fuel injector can cause significant performance issues such as rough idling, poor acceleration, and a lack of power. These problems can make driving difficult and unpleasant, affecting overall vehicle handling.

  • Reduced Fuel Efficiency

    • When a fuel injector is faulty, it may not deliver fuel efficiently to the engine, leading to poor fuel economy. You may notice a drop in miles per gallon (MPG), which means you’ll need to refuel more often.

  • Increased Emissions

    •  A malfunctioning fuel injector can disrupt the engine’s air-fuel mixture, resulting in higher emissions. This not only affects your vehicle’s environmental impact but could also cause it to fail emissions tests.

  • Engine Stalling

    • A bad fuel injector can cause the engine to stall or hesitate, particularly during acceleration. This can be dangerous, especially if it happens while driving at high speeds or in traffic.

  • Check Engine Light

    • Often, a failing fuel injector will trigger the check engine light on your dashboard. While this light may not immediately indicate a fuel injector issue, it’s a sign that something is wrong and needs attention.

  • Difficulty Starting

    • If you have trouble starting your vehicle or notice that it takes longer than usual, it could be due to a malfunctioning fuel injector. Inconsistent fuel delivery can affect the engine's ability to start properly.

  • Potential for Further Damage

    • Driving with a bad fuel injector can lead to more severe engine problems over time. If left unaddressed, it can cause damage to other components, leading to costly repairs.

While it’s technically possible to drive with a bad fuel injector, doing so can compromise your vehicle’s performance, fuel efficiency, and safety. Ignoring the symptoms and continuing to drive with a faulty injector can lead to further damage and more expensive repairs down the line. If you suspect that your fuel injector is failing, it’s important to have it inspected and replaced by a professional as soon as possible to avoid potential complications and ensure your vehicle runs smoothly.
